Regulations governing septic systems differ considerably from one jurisdiction to a different. Local governments often impose specific necessities primarily based on population density, soil characteristics, and the local environment. These regulations determine the place septic techniques may be put in, how they need to be designed, and the maintenance practices that have to be followed. Compliance isn't merely a authorized obligation; it's important for the protection and preservation of water resources - septic tank repair services West Kelowna BC.


Installation of a septic system typically begins with obtaining the required permits. Householders should submit detailed plans that define the system's design and placement. This step is important because it ensures that the system will meet native requirements and performance correctly inside its designated environment. Regulatory companies usually assess these plans to substantiate that they adjust to health and environmental safety requirements.


Once a septic system is put in, ongoing maintenance is required to make certain that it continues to operate successfully. Regulations mandate regular inspections, usually every three to 5 years, relying on the kind of system and its usage. Homeowners should concentrate on the maintenance requirements stipulated by their local regulations and guarantee they adhere to these pointers. This could embody pumping the septic tank, inspecting parts, and sustaining drain fields.

Environmental considerations are also paramount within septic system regulations. Many jurisdictions have established buffer zones that decide how shut septic techniques can be to bodies of water, wells, or other delicate areas. These buffer zones assist prevent contamination of ingesting water sources and protect aquatic ecosystems. Compliance with these environmental regulations usually necessitates careful planning and site evaluation before installing a septic system.

What are the frequent signs that my septic system wants maintenance?


Signs of septic system issues may include slow drains, foul odors, sewage backups, and standing water around the Full Report drain field. If you notice any of these problems, it’s essential to contact a licensed septic professional promptly to stop additional injury.
